The Squier Affinity Series 5-String Jazz Bass in 3-Color Sunburst combines a lightweight poplar body and slim 'C'-shaped neck with dual single-coil pickups and vintage open-gear tuners, delivering classic Fender-inspired tone and modern playability for aspiring and professional bassists alike.

Decent, but should be “scratch & dent”
1) Shipping - arrived on time, but could not track via UPS and according to Amazon, the package still has not arrived. Seems like a UPS systems issue.2) Scratched - the guitar was scratched in a couple of different locations on the forward facing side of the body (2 scratches near the upper side of the pick guard, and 1 scratch near upper side of the bridge and first pick up). Should be priced for scratch and dent, not full price. I’m not going through the hassle of trying to get another one based on the conditions some have reported as I might just get stuck in a never ending cycle. The item should be discounted by the seller.3) Slices Your Hands - the frets are just a tiny bit too long and they slice your hand as you move it up and down the neck. This is a manufacturing quality control issue. I have been playing guitars for 36 years and have never encountered this issue with any other guitar. I had to purchase a $35 fret filing block to correct the issue.4) Playability - once the strings get settled in, the bass played really nice for the price.5) Tone - Im not crazy about the sound I’m getting, but it is a passive bass. Different strings may help a little. The highs are very bright, but the lows are a little brighter than what I prefer as well. Could upgrade to an active system, or maybe run it through a pre-amp for an additional $40-250.5) No protection - the bass does not even come with a gig bag to be clear. So you will need to factor that in to your total cost if you plan to be mobile with it at all. Add another $30-$175 to your price.6) Appearance - I went with the Olympic White option. You can upgrade the pick up for $10-100 depending on how custom you want to get. I went with a cheap upgrade.Overall, I like the bass, but should be paying a discounted price for the scratches and the fret problems, as should anyone else who received a damaged product.Bass $299(Should be discounted like $50)Case $135Fret File $35Pick guard upgrade - $11Total $480Could possibly buy a used/broken in Fender Player (Made in Mexico) version with a hard case for this total amount. Something to consider.

Nice bass
This is a nice looking bass for what it cost. Seems to be well made and sounds good through my 500 hundred watt Fender Rumble amp. Just be aware it will need a set up. The string saddles were adjusted all the way up from the factory. There are lots of videos on You Tube showing exactly how to do it with basic tools. I'm happy with it.
